Understanding Unexpected Cardiac Arrest
Sudden cardiac arrest is a sudden loss of heart function, causing cessation of blood circulation to essential body organs. It can happen without caution and is frequently deadly if not treated promptly.
Signs and Signs of Sudden Heart Arrest
- Loss of Consciousness: The individual might instantly fall down or become unresponsive. Absence of Breathing: A lack of typical breathing shows instant activity is required. No Pulse: Monitoring responsiveness and pulse is crucial for figuring out the next steps.

Best Practices for Taking Turns on Compressions
Ensure compressions are continual without interruption. Switch roles every 2 minutes or after 5 cycles (30 compressions adhered to by 2 breaths). Maintain composure; fatigue brings about lower compression deepness which endangers effectiveness.Lower Compression Deepness vs Correct Technique
Effective mouth-to-mouth resuscitation requires preserving appropriate compression depth; also superficial compressions decrease blood flow efficacy.
Optimal Compression Depth
For grownups:
- At least 2 inches (5 cm)
For youngsters:
- About 1/3 the depth of the chest
Slow Compression Price and Its Implications
A slow-moving compression price can hamper blood flow during mouth-to-mouth resuscitation, making it essential for rescuers to stick strictly to suggested guidelines.
Recommended Compression Rate
At the very least 100-- 120 compressions per min is considered optimal for maintaining circulation throughout cardiac arrest situations.
